What is CRM?

CRM stands for customer relationship management, and it is a software solution that manages customer data and interactions. It helps businesses to organize, track, and analyze customer data for marketing, sales, and customer service purposes. In essence, CRM is a tool that businesses use to manage their relationships with customers and prospects.

How does CRM Work?

CRM software works by collecting and storing customer data in a database. The data can be retrieved from various sources such as social media, email, and phone calls. The software then analyzes the data and provides businesses with valuable insights into customer behavior. Businesses can then use this information to target their marketing campaigns more effectively, provide better customer service, and increase sales opportunities.

The Types of CRM

There are three main types of CRM, and these include:

Operational CRM

Operational CRM is designed to automate and streamline business processes such as marketing, sales, and customer service. This type of CRM focuses on customer interactions and provides businesses with tools to manage customer data and track customer behavior.

Analytical CRM

Analytical CRM is designed to analyze customer data and provide businesses with valuable insights into customer behavior. This type of CRM focuses on data mining and helps businesses to improve their marketing campaigns, customer service, and sales opportunities.

Collaborative CRM

Collaborative CRM is designed to facilitate communication and collaboration between different departments within a business. This type of CRM focuses on improving teamwork and knowledge sharing to enhance customer service and increase sales opportunities.
